A humoral factor extracted from calf thymus (
THF
) restores the immunocompetence of spleen cells from neonatally thymectomized (NTx) mice to induce an in vitro graft-vs-host (GVH) response. This acquistion of immunocompetence consists of a series of biochemical events, the first of which involves an obligatory rapid increase in
adenyl cyclase
acitivity and in intracellular levels of cyclic AMP. Protein synthesis occurs as a further step in the events leading to induction of immunocompetence by
THF
and could be blocked by cycloheximide with the consequent abolishment of the immunocompetence of the lymphoid cells tested. The induction of competence by
THF
is accompanied by a simultaneous reduction in DNA synthesis resulting from the increase in intracellular cyclic AMP levels. These steps have been studied in the absence of antigenic stimulation which is not required for the induction of competence by
THF
. Spleen extracts prepared by a similar procedure as
THF
were found to be devoid of the properties described above.

Experiments reported here were performed to understand the mechanism by which
THF
increases the immunocompetence of spleen cells from NTx mice. Dibutyryl cAMP or substances which increase intracellular levels of cAMP in lymphocytes such as Poly(A:U), theophylline, or PGE(2) were shown to mimic the effect of
THF
and confer reactivity in an in vitro GvH response to spleen cells from NTx mice. Flufenamic acid, an antagonist to PGE(2), was shown to inhibit the induction of competence by this substance. It was found that
THF
induces competence by activating membranal
adenyl cyclase
which leads to a rise in intracellular cAMP in thymus-derived cells only. These biochemical changes occur before antigenic stimulation and are unrelated to antigenic challenge. These findings indicate that
THF
exerts its effect via cAMP and are in agreement with the concepts which permit to classify
THF
as a thymus hormone.
